Transaction 16709c1fb557ef31ce49c53f386ff71353ba72e791cbd34a27f23e57d5a91e91

125 Input
1 Outputs
  • 16709c1fb557ef31ce49c53f386ff71353ba72e791cbd34a27f23e57d5a91e91:0
  • value  2403521273
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P